An Effective PSA

There are some really bad PSA’s out there but there are also some really good ones. A PSA's goal is to persuade an audience to take a specific action or adopt a particular viewpoint on a cause or social issue. 

What I think makes a bad PSA:
  • It's not realistic
  • The storyline is exaggerated
  • It tells the story poorly
  • It drags on for more than 60 seconds
  • Instead of wanting to take action after watching it the audience is just annoyed

What I think makes a great PSA:
  • It is empathetic and gives a sense of caring about a problem 
  • It builds trust with their audience
  • It tells a story
  • It holds your interest
  • It gets to the point in 30 to 60 seconds
  • It makes you want to do something
  • It actually gets the public to take action after watching it
